--- Comment #6 from bintoro <[email protected]> --- > The global default language setting is effective only when not overridden by > a template. That is, the default language embedded in the template must be > “None”. Correction: it looks like a template’s language setting always takes precedence even if it’s “None”. In other words, the global default language setting serves no purpose when using a custom template.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.
